Tābiʿī
Salmah bin Kahayl al-Hadrami
سلمة بن كهيل بن حصين
- Reliability
- Thiqah
- Lifespan
- d. 122 AH
- Place
- al-Kufa
8 hadiths in Sahih al-Bukhari
